Hi Everybody,

Quick question I'm hoping somebody can help me with please. I've previously been told I should avoid making changes directly to a downloaded WordPress theme, but should create a child theme instead, to avoid any problems with future updates to the theme.

Trouble is I've made some changes (big and small) to all of the php files listed below - not just the CSS file - so am wondering if I were to start again from scratch and do it properly by creating a child theme, wouldn't I have to keep on updating all of these other files each time the original adult theme is updated?
